Kilalinda Camp

Kilalinda camp offers an unprecedented degree of privacy, seclusion and luxury. On the borders of Tsavo East National Park, it stands amid acacia groves and verdant gardens on the banks of the Athi River. Behind the camp runs the Yatta Plateau, and on a clear day, there are views of Kilimanjaro to the south. An ancient valley frozen in time the Yatta plateau is a ridge or tongue of lava about 300km long and a maximum of 10km wide, which forms a seemingly never-ending backdrop to Tsavo East. One of the longest lava flows in the world, the Yatta affords fabulous views across the rolling reaches of the Park, is an ornithological paradise and makes a peerless sundowner or picnic spot. It is made up of a form of lava known as phonolite, which is between 11 and 13.6 million years old. Current thought suggests that the Yatta Plateau was formed when a stream of lava flowed across the land until it found its way into an ancient river valley. The lava then flowed down the valley; taking on the shape of its contours, until eventually it cooled and solidified.  Thereafter the surrounding land was gradually lowered by erosion leaving the frozen river of lava standing up as a ridge. 

Location

Tsavo East National Park is easily accessible by air and road, and is approximately 160 kilometers from Mombasa, and 326 kilometers from Nairobi. 40 minute flight from Nairobi by private charter. 

Accommodation

There are six ensuite cottage rooms, each of which has been ecologically constructed and features earth walls, olive-wood pillars, hand-woven rugs and giant four-poster beds. One cottage is larger and features its own Jacuzzi/plunge pool and private bar. 

Dining and bars

The central dining room seats 16 and features an open pool bar with views over the river and pool. Sunrise breakfasts and sundowners are also offered on a panoramic platform high in the boughs of a giant baobab tree.

Kilalinda takes great pride in providing first class cuisine. Most of the fresh vegetables are grown on a nearby farm and the breads and pastries are all home-made.
